Charity Christian School
I. Our Purpose & Goal – The beliefs that we hold most dear and upon which we base our lives were being circumvented by the public schools. It was unrealistic to expect that a public school would or could teach and instill into our young people our Christian values. Because of this, Charity Christian School was founded. There are three basic goals that form the basis of our existence:
A. So that we as adults could pass our faith and beliefs on to our young people.
B. So that we could pass on to our young people the knowledge and wisdom they will need to function successfully in the modern world.
C. So that we may separate our young people from the influence of those who do not hold to our beliefs of faith and Christian living. We shall endeavor to provide an atmosphere that is conducive to Christian learning. We shall strive to be examples to our young people so that they can look up to us as role models for Christian living. We shall strive to provide a place that is separated from the world and dedicated to the Christian instruction of our young people.
II. Education Standard – On average, Christian school students test one to two grades above the national average. Our students will be held accountable for every assignment. Graduating to the next grade requires that a student be diligent in completing daily work and studying for quizzes and tests.
III. Curriculum – We have chosen to use Accelerated Christian Education (A.C.E.) curriculum. This curriculum is academically sound as well as spiritually oriented. The Bible (KJV) is the hub of the student’s learning experience. The Bible and the teachings of Jesus Christ do not replace academic subjects, yet they are the center core of the curriculum.
IV. Enrollment – Charity Christian School provides education for K-5 through the twelfth grade. Charity Christian School admits only children who are members of Ray Avenue Baptist Church or whose families are members of Ray Avenue Baptist. However, even then, new students must meet specified criteria for enrollment.
V. School Schedule – School begins on the 23rd of August. Students attend classes Monday, Tuesday, Wednesday, & Thursday from 8:00 AM to 3:30 PM. There are no classes held on Fridays, Saturdays, or Sundays. The school year lasts thirty-six weeks minus holiday vacations. Parents are expected to attend scheduled Parent Teacher Meetings
